Risk Management & Safety at Auburn University is excited to begin the search for an Environmental Protection Specialist! This individual performs duties for a variety of environmental compliance services for Fort Benning, Georgia.
Areas of specialization:
Hazardous Waste Management, Non‑RCRA waste, Clean Water Act Compliance, Clean Air Act compliance, and Storage Tank Management.
As this position will support the IGSA with Fort Benning, candidates will be required to successfully obtain a Common Access Card (CAC) to access the government network. If the procurement of a CAC is delayed, the candidate’s probationary period may need to be extended to allow this requirement to be met. Failing to meet this minimum requirement may result in termination.
Responsibilities- Conduct and perform site surveys, assessments, inspections, and evaluations to ensure regulated facilities and units or activities are properly managing environmental features of concern.
- Ensure the site maintains continuous compliance with federal, state, local, and university regulations; recommend control measures when needed.
- Provide periodic, annual, or comprehensive reports for each site visit and the results of such assessments for review, evaluation, and corrective action; maintain a database of all site visits, inspections, including facility information, point of contact information, inspection reports, and any other environmental requirements.
- May conduct chemical analysis for environmental compliance.
- Proactively seek new ways to improve overall safety and environmental performance.
- Participate in ongoing environmental and safety training.
- May participate in the chemical and/or hazardous material emergency response team; assist with spill cleanup, report spills to proper points of contact, and file spill reports both internally and externally.
